• Left-back arrives from Benfica as understudy to Tierney
  • Lokonga deal in place for initial €17.5m from Anderlecht

Arsenal have confirmed the signing of the left-back Nuno Tavares from Benfica. The 21-year-old is the club’s first arrival of the summer in a deal worth €8m (£6.8m) plus add-ons.

Tavares’s purchase is due to be followed by that of the midfielder Albert Sambi Lokonga from Anderlecht. Arsenal have agreed to pay €17.5m plus add-ons that could take the fee for the Belgian to about €21m.
